Yet again, this year’s runway rock show will be held at the iconic First Avenue in downtown Minneapolis. An MNfashion production now in its seventh installment, the Voltage show is the marquee event of Spring MNfashion Week each year and serves as the public debut of each designer’s spring 2011 line. A fresh twist on traditional runway, models walk to the sounds of the crème de la crème of local bands—who serve as models themselves. More than simply a runway rock show, Voltage: Fashion Amplified also serves as a design incubator by helping designers make a business of their art. Hands-on Design Workshops, meetings with the Voltage Design Panel and appointments with wholesale fabric reps help designers develop, source and create their spring lines. Each year brings evolution to MNfashion Week and debuting this year are The Shows— classic, design-focused runway shows featuring Voltage veteran designers. Additionally, these designers as well as current Voltage designers premiered their collections at the second annual January 20th invite-only press and buyer event.

Voltage: Fashion Amplified is MNfashion's premier event, held annually during Spring MNfashion Week. It seamlessly combines rock and runway into an intimate mix of sound and style. Through its annual events, Voltage seeks to foster collaboration, engender community and unite music and fashion while providing a national forum for local talent. MNfashion is a locally-bred organization dedicated to providing resources and professional development to the local fashion community that will enhance and support a thriving, sustainable local fashion industry.

PINK MINK

Pink Mink was what happened when everyone was making other plans. Christy Hunt had returned from 2 years of touring as the guitarist for the Von Bondies and posted a defeatist post about quitting music and going back to school. Longtime friend Arzu Gokcen saw this post and threatened to lock her in a closet with her guitar until she changed her mind. The two, at similar crossroads in their musical paths, decided to give playing together a shot. And it worked beautifully.

COMMUNIST DAUGHTER

4 years ago, John Solomon walked away from music. After struggling with addiction and a brief stint in jail, he broke up his critically acclaimed band Friends Like These and moved to a small town in Wisconsin. And supposedly, that was that. But even though Solomon left music, music never left him.

ME AND MY ARROW

"There's been a lot of talk about the size of local band Me & My Arrow, but it's warranted, since there are only a small handful of Minneapolis stages that can accommodate them comfortably. They've recently trimmed down from nine members to a relatively lean seven, but in order to pull off the anthemic, heavily layered sound that's become the band's stock-in-trade, the largeness is a necessity rather than overkill.

FORT WILSON RIOT

As they tumble out of the back of a maroon minivan into clubs, bars, living rooms and festivals across America, Fort Wilson Riot are liable to become a favorite local band, no matter where you live. Splitting their time between unstoppable touring and incessant recording, the Minneapolis-based duo of Amy Hager and Jacob Mullis have no shortness of ambition.

PHANTOM TAILS

Phantom Tails formed in early 2009. In fact, the band never really formed so much as it emerged as part of a natural progression. All four members had been playing together for some time in other bands before indulging to embark on a more electronic, gritty, and concise musical path.
